On 07/17/1982 at approximately 1330 hours, hikers found the decedent on the East side of Sheep Flats, south of Mt. Rose Highway. She was found lying prone on the ground with defects to the back of her head. Mens underwear had been used to cover the defects. She was clad except for being barefoot. Her livor mortis was still blanching when she was found.

She also has very unique dentals. She is missing her right lateral incisor (#7), but not the left (#10). Her right canine has come forward to close the gap, so it appears to be either a genetic condition, or a condition that she has had since she was young. She also has a veneer or bonding over her upper-left front tooth (#9).
